In loving memory of

Doris Ellen Matsunami
February 11, 1934 - November 22, 2020

Doris Ellen Weathers was born February 11, 1934 in Anthon, Iowa as the fourth child of Merritt and Hepsy Weathers.
Doris met Manuel Yoshio Matsunami in 1952 and they were married on September 4, 1955. They had six children: Randy, Rick, Renee, Russ, Rhonda and Risé. The family was honored by Omaha Northwest High School (where all six children graduated) in its inaugural Alumni Family Achievement Award in 2012.
Doris attended business school in Omaha and together with Manuel, owned and ran Matsunami Jewelers in Omaha for over 30 years. Doris was the "official" chauffeur for the family to all of the children's sports and extracurricular activities. She also was skilled at knitting and crocheting, gifting family members afghans, scarves and hats for special occasions. Doris served as a Treasurer for the Ladies Auxiliary of VFW Post #3421 and was also a 50+ year member of Eastern Star.
Manuel passed away on April 6, 2019. Doris is survived by brother Richard (Lois) Weathers, brothers-in-law Marvin Hansen, Juichi (Emiko) Matsunami, sisters-in-law Tomoko Matsunami, Natchi (David) Furakawa, all children and their spouses, 12 grandchildren, 11 great grandchildren; numerous nieces and nephews.
